What we do
The CNC protects civil nuclear sites and nuclear materials in England and Scotland. We also police and protect other, non-nuclear critical infrastructure.
CNC is part of the Civil Nuclear Police Authority.

Please note, the CNC is a specialist national infrastructure police force responsible for protecting nuclear power stations and material and as such does not investigate crime, routinely make arrests or deal with missing people cases. Please do not submit FOI requests of this nature to the CNC as they will generally have a nil response.
